Frederick Goldman Acquires Lab-Grown Brand

By Rapaport News / March 11, 2019 / www.diamonds.net / Article Link

RAPAPORT... Jewelry manufacturer Frederick Goldman has purchasedlab-grown-jewelry brand Love Earth to accelerate its entry into the synthetic-diamondbusiness. "The market for lab-grown diamonds is expanding rapidly,"Frederick Goldman CEO Jonathan Goldman said last week. "We have spent the pastyear studying how we would enter this business. Our purchase of the Love Earthbrand has expedited those plans." The industry needs to find new and innovative ways to appealto consumers in order to compete, Goldman added. The brand includes bridal and fashion pieces. Frederick Goldman has built a new manufacturing facility exclusivelyfor its synthetic-diamond jewelry, it said. Dan Schneider, the founder of Love Earth and a formerdirector at jewelry manufacturer Stuller, has joined Frederick Goldman as vicepresident of sales. The Love Earth collection will debut in stores in June. Image: Love Earth lab-grown jewelry. (Frederick Goldman)
